    Russian drone attack on mine worker bus in Ukraine’s east kills 12

    KYIV: A Russian drone assault on a bus carrying mine employees in Ukraine’s central-eastern Dnipropetrovsk area on Sunday (Feb 1) killed not less than 12 folks, officers mentioned.

    The bus was driving within the neighborhood of Ternivka, a city about 65km from the entrance line, in keeping with police.

    DTEK, Ukraine’s largest personal power agency, mentioned these killed had been travelling from one among its mining services within the area after that they had completed their shift.

    Photographs printed by Ukraine’s state emergency service confirmed what gave the impression to be an empty bus, its aspect home windows shattered and windscreen hanging from the entrance.

    “The enemy drone hit close to an organization shuttle bus within the Pavlograd district. Preliminarily, 12 folks had been killed and 7 extra had been wounded,” the top of the regional army administration, Oleksandr Ganzha, mentioned on Telegram.

    AFP was not in a position to instantly confirm the circumstances of the assault.
